Retail Cashier Nights and Weekends

Charlotte, NC 28277On-sitePosted 23 hours ago
Business Services & Consulting

About the Role

Store Associate

Deliver friendly customer service, help customers shop our store, and find what they're looking for. Ensure all customers receive a fast and friendly checkout experience. Complete truck unloading and merchandise duties throughout the store including maintaining storerecovery standards to deliver our Brand Promises.

Help customers shop, locate products, and provide them with solutions

Provide a fast and friendly checkout experience; execute cash handling to standards

Engage customers on the benefits of the Rewards program and Private Label Credit Cards and complete enrollments

Educate customers on the Voice of Customer (VOC) survey

Assist with Omni channel processes, including Buy Online Pickup in Store (BOPIS) and Ship From Store (SFS)

Participate in the truck unload, stocking, and planogram (POGs) processes

Responsible to complete merchandise recovery and maintenance including the merchandise return / go back process and general store recovery to ensure a well-merchandised and in-stock store

Perform Store In Stock Optimization (SISO) and AD set duties as assigned

Support shrink and safety programs

Adhere to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and Company programs to ensure compliance with applicable laws and requirements; execute Company policies and standards

Interact with others in an accepting and respectful manner; remain positive and respectful, even in difficult situations; promote commitment to the organization's vision and values; project a positive image and serve as a role model for other Team Members

Cross trained in Custom Framing selling and production

Other duties as assigned

Preferred Knowledge/Skills/Abilities

Preferred Type of experience the job requires

Retail and/or customer service experience preferred

Physical Requirements

Ability to remain standing for long periods of time

Ability to move throughout the store

Regular bending, lifting, carrying, reaching, and stretching

Lifting heavy boxes and accessing high shelves by ladder or similar equipment

If you need help performing these essential functions of your job, please contact your supervisor so that we may engage in the interactive process with you to determine if a reasonable accommodation is available.

Work Environment

Public retail store setting taking care of our customers; all public areas are climate controlled; some stock rooms may not be climate controlled; some outdoor work if assigned to retrieve shopping carts or while unloading trucks; Frame shop contains glass cutter and heat press; work hours include nights, weekends and early mornings

Applicants in the U.S. must satisfy federal, state, and local legal requirements of the job. Michaels requires all team members in this role to be at least sixteen (16) years or older.
